How To Fix /SAPMP/PP_BD014 - Maximum production length value has been deleted


SAP Error Message - Details

  • Message type: E = Error

  • Message class: /SAPMP/PP_BD -

  • Message number: 014

  • Message text: Maximum production length value has been deleted

  • What is the cause and solution for SAP error message /SAPMP/PP_BD014 - Maximum production length value has been deleted ?

    The SAP error message /SAPMP/PP_BD014 Maximum production length value has been deleted typically occurs in the context of production planning and control within the SAP system. This error indicates that the maximum production length value, which is a parameter used in production planning, has been deleted or is missing in the system.

    Cause:

    1. Deletion of Configuration: The maximum production length value may have been deleted from the configuration settings in the system.
    2. Missing Master Data: The relevant master data (like production resources/tools or work centers) may not have the required settings defined.
    3. Transport Issues: If the configuration was transported from one system to another (e.g., from development to production), it might not have been included or was incorrectly transported.
    4. User Authorization: Sometimes, the user may not have the necessary authorizations to view or access the maximum production length settings.

    Solution:

    1. Check Configuration:

      • Go to the configuration settings in the SAP system and verify if the maximum production length value is defined. This can typically be found in the production planning (PP) area.
      • Use transaction codes like SPRO to access the configuration settings and navigate to the relevant sections.
    2. Review Master Data:

      • Check the master data for the production resources or work centers involved in the production process. Ensure that all necessary parameters, including the maximum production length, are correctly set.
    3. Transport Logs:

      • If the issue arose after a transport, check the transport logs to ensure that all necessary objects were included in the transport request.
    4. User Authorizations:

      • Ensure that the user encountering the error has the appropriate authorizations to access and modify the production planning settings.
    5. Recreate the Value:

      • If the maximum production length value was deleted, you may need to recreate it. Consult with your SAP PP consultant or system administrator to determine the appropriate value based on your production requirements.
    6. Consult Documentation:

      • Refer to SAP documentation or help resources for specific guidance on the maximum production length settings and their implications in your production planning processes.
